## Break-Glass: FeedCheck Validator

FeedCheck validates podcast RSS feeds for the Quillcast platform. Its config vault is sealed; routine changes go through the Marlowe team. If validation is down and no maintainer responds within 30 minutes, invoke break-glass from the ops panel. Confirm the incident number, acknowledge the audit warning, and unseal the vault with the passphrase that follows below.

vault phrase of baguf-haweg = kasael-lamwyn-kelax-kasok-tamael-kelmir-holiel-aldvan-casvan-praath-kasax-casael-gileth

Ticket: Staging env misconfigured for Siftgate bloom filter

The bloom layer in front of the Pellet KV store is rejecting all lookups in staging because the env file was copied from the dev template without credentials. False-positive tuning values are fine; only the auth line is missing. To unblock the weekly demo, the Pellet admission secret must be set on the following line.

env line for yaguf-fajop: LEDGER_TOKEN13=fb08984397349

- [ ] Step 7: Archive cold storage buckets (Glacierline tier). Confirm both ceremony witnesses are present, verify bucket manifests match the Oxbow ledger, then seal the archive key shares. Plugin authors may observe but not handle shares. Once sealed, the archive index itself is encrypted and can only be reopened with the passphrase below.

vault phrase of badup-hahig = tamael-aldael-kelmir-istael-fenok-istwyn-tamius-jorath-oliion